Conservatories are generally glass-enclosed areas that can serve various functions, such as dining areas, sun lounges, and even indoor gardens. They can be built in a variety of styles, consisting of Victorian, Edwardian, Lean-To, and Gable-Fronted.
DesignFeaturesBenefitsVictorianClassy, ornate design with several aspectsA timeless appearance that includes appealEdwardianRoomy with an easy rectangular shapeOptimum for modern livingLean-ToSimple structure that leans versus a wallEconomical and flexibleGable-FrontedHigh ceiling with angled roofTakes full advantage of light and area
With different styles available, it is very important to pick both a style that complements your home and a professional who can perform the installation flawlessly.

For how long does it usually take to install a conservatory?The installation duration can differ based on the size and intricacy of the conservatory, however most projects are finished within 4 to 8 weeks after the design completion. 2. What products are typically used for conservatories?Typical materials
include uPVC, aluminum, timber, or a mix, each
using various aesthetic and thermal advantages. 3. Are there guidelines for building a conservatory?Yes, local structure regulations might use. A professional installer will guide you through the essential permits and ensure that your Expert Conservatory Installer complies with local guidelines. 4. Can I customize my conservatory design?Absolutely. Lots of installers use bespoke designs tailored to your preferences and home style.
